Developer The Chinese Room and publisher Secret Mode have today announced the launch date of their narrative horror game Still Wakes the Deep. For the occasion, a new trailer was aired:



Still Wakes the Deep is a return to the first-person narrative horror genre from The Chinese Room, creator of critically acclaimed games such as Amnesia: A Machine for Pigs, Everybody’s Gone to the Rapture, and Dear Esther.

You are an off-shore oil rig worker, fighting for your life through a vicious storm, perilous surroundings, and the dark, freezing North Sea waters. All lines of communication have been severed. All exits are gone. All that remains is to face the unknowable horror that’s come aboard.

Still Wakes the Deep launches June 18 on Xbox Series X|S, PS5 and PC. It will also be available with Game Pass for console and PC.
